We tend to travel a little differently. Rather than rushing through all the tourist attractions, we enjoy slowing down, soaking in the local culture and experiencing how people actually live. Most of our trip was spent exploring the Blok M area on foot. We loved the bakmi at Bakmi Piring, the Sambal Matah stall in the basement food court (good enough that we went back twice!), and even spent a night at Jaya Pub, Jakarta's oldest pub. Great atmosphere, friendly crew and an amazing live band. We also visited Pasar Loak Jatinegara, Pasar Pagi Mangga Dua and Grand Indonesia Mall, while making plenty of stops at roadside food stalls along the way. Honestly, we wished we had more than one stomach! One of the biggest highlights was Taman Safari Bogor. Although it took us about three hours to get there, it was absolutely worth it. Feeding lions and driving through the safari while feeding free-roaming animals was an unforgettable experience. Easily one of the best wildlife parks we've visited, and we're already planning to bring our nephews there one day. To end our holiday, we spent time at Pulau Macan in the Thousand Islands. Clear waters, beautiful weather and a wonderful crew made it the perfect way to wrap up our trip. Yes, Jakarta traffic can be a real killjoy, but staying longer and choosing a walkable neighbourhood like Blok M meant we never felt rushed. Indonesia has left us wanting more, and we're already looking forward to exploring other parts of the country on our next visit.

I enjoyed the walkability of the city. 15-20 minutes walking from the hotel put me right in the shopping areas. Although the traffic was busy, crossing the streets was very manageable. The Malioboro shopping area offered great finds in clothing, food, and souvenirs. Although my husband and I enjoyed our time in Jogja, we became a bit annoyed by two individuals who tried to push us to buy Batik paintings. It felt like a bait and swith when we went to the Sultan's palace and then became redirected to a Batik school by someone claiming to be with the ministry of tourism. This did not taint our view of Jogja since most major cities have some aspect of this.

Some nice tea states, craters and volcanoes within an hour's to two hours' drive. Braga Street is excellent experience early in the morning and at dusk. Nice Restaurants and delicious street food at the night market. It was an excellent place to take travel photos of Dutch era heritage buildings and vibrant markets. Friendly locals. I used the ride sharing service Grab to get around the city. The lively atmosphere of the Braga Street with plenty of restaurants and small food outlets were a big attraction for my family.

ijen is pretty much overrated, it's a nice 6-hour-ish hike with above medium difficulty, the flame is underwhelming which is slightly bigger than a camp fire and the crater? go to Bromo instead. With the current volcano incident related to the Brazilian tourist, I am more convinced that people should be aware of tour guide's quality and training in East Java. Upon reading some brief information about traveling to Ijen, I found to mandatory in getting a guide, I went there alone and caught weird looks from other guides, some avoided my interactions when they found out I was alone, some others was good and paying attention.
